Title: Preventing Gun Violence in the Workplace
Publication Date: September 08, 2008
What does it say?
The risk of workplace homicide is 7 times higher in workplaces that allow guns compared with workplaces that prohibit all weapons (p. 19). Each of the 500 workplace homicides each year costs society approximately $800,000. The report recommends that employers’ adopt no-weapons policies as part of their efforts to reduce gun violence.
